Geospatial research in archaeology often relies on datasets previously collected by other archaeologists or third-party groups, such as state or federal government entities. This article discusses our work with geospatial datasets for identifying, documenting, and evaluating prehistoric and historic water features in the western United States. As part of a project on water heritage and long-term views on water management, our research has involved aggregating spatial data from an array of open access and semi-open access sources. Archaeologists use teeth to estimate the age an animal died based on tooth eruption, growth, and wear. Animal age estimations then inform archaeologists about when and why archaeological sites were occupied. However, to date, no concise and repeatable practice exists to age estimate teeth. Therefore, we propose a new tooth age estimation methodology, in this case using bison teeth. The new tooth aging method uses GIS mapping software to draw tooth surfaces and then calculate tooth surface areas of known-age bison teeth. Suitability modeling is a useful approach for exploring human interactions with their environments. Within a geographic information system (GIS) environment, locations are weighted relative to each other, resulting in a landscape hierarchy that displays regions from least to most suitable. Suitability modeling is used in various disciplines, from urban planning to natural resources, but a gap exists in research concerning social human behavior. This method can especially contribute to the investigation of social inequality at archaeological sites by considering multiple attributes within a site. With generous support from the National Science Foundation, we have spent the past four years developing an archaeological radiocarbon database for the United States. Here, we highlight the importance of spatial data for open-access, national-scale archaeological databases and the development of paleodemography research. We propose a new method for analyzing radiocarbon time series in the context of paleoclimate models. This method forces us to confront one of the central challenges to realizing the full potential of national-scale databases: the quality of the spatial data accompanying radiocarbon dates.
